What a Beatles birthday GIF with audio actually is

A typical Beatles birthday GIF with sound combines a short, looping video clip or animated sequence with a snippet of a Beatles track tied to celebration, most often the song "Birthday" from the 1968 double album commonly known as the "White Album." The visual layer usually features themed elements such as a birthday cake, balloons, vintage Beatles album art, or animated caricatures of the "Fab Four," while the audio is either baked into the file (as MP4 + GIF hybrids) or handled by the host app's GIF keyboard, which fetches the sound separately.

Because traditional GIFs do not natively support sound, many "with sound" Beatles birthday clips are actually short MP4 loops or special formats that only play audio when the client app or platform explicitly supports it. This distinction explains why a Beatles birthday GIF with sound might appear mute on some platforms (for example, older email clients) but play audio within WhatsApp, Instagram or Facebook if the GIF is embedded as a video-like asset.

How to troubleshoot a mute Beatles birthday GIF

If your Beatles birthday GIF with sound appears muted, start by checking whether the file is actually a GIF or an MP4: many platforms only play audio when the clip is loaded as video. Next, verify that the host app has permission to play sound and that the device's volume is not turned down; finally, try sending the same file within a different app (for example, WhatsApp instead of an email client) to confirm that the audio exists in the underlying asset.

Why do some Beatles birthday GIFs play without sound?

This happens because standard GIF files do not natively support audio; many "Beatles birthday GIFs with sound" are actually MP4 or webM files that only play audio when the host app renders them as video. If you open the GIF in an email client or older browser that treats it as a purely visual format, the sound will be stripped out, leaving the Beatles birthday animation silent.

How big should a Beatles birthday GIF with sound be?

For sharing on messaging apps, a Beatles birthday GIF with sound should ideally be under 10 seconds in duration and under 5-8 MB in file size to avoid upload delays and ensure smooth playback. Editors such as CapCut and similar tools often compress the file automatically, but keeping the resolution around 720p and limiting the bitrate to moderate levels helps balance audio quality with app compatibility.
